万码皆空的博客
Published on

修复”PANIC Missing emulator engine program for 'x86'的问题

Authors
  • avatar
    Name
    万码皆空
    Twitter

尝试使用emulator命令启动模拟器时,发现报错:

PANIC: Missing emulator engine program for 'x86' CPU.

通过查找资料,发现原来是android sdk里有两个emulator,一个在Android/sdk/tools文件夹下,一个在Android/sdk/emulator下。由于我们一般会把Android/sdk/tools文件夹加入到PATH环境变量,所以我们使用的是Android/sdk/tools下的emulator,这样错误就产生了。

解决方法很简单,把Android/sdk/emulator 加入到PATH环境变量中即可。

export PATH=$PATH:$ANDROID_SDK/emulator:$ANDROID_SDK/platform-tools:$ANDROID_SDK/tools